最近在自己写 python 包,在服务器上使用时发现了一些问题。



因为使用的阿里云的服务器,默认使用的他们的镜像,但是发现同步很慢,无法满足高频的开发节奏,而是用 pypi 就会经常超时或直接被墙。

从网上找到一些国内其他的镜像

其中豆瓣的最好,更新最快

使用

1
$ pip install <package_name> -i http://pypi.doubanio.com/simple/

全局使用

修改 ~/.pip/pip.conf

1
2
3
4
5
[global]
index-url=http://pypi.douban.com/simple/

[install]
trusted-host=pypi.douban.com

最后还有一种情况是,命名镜像源中已经有了最新上传的包,但是通过 pip install --upgrade wwx 并不能更新到,索性只好直接找到包地址安装

1
$ pip install https://files.pythonhosted.org/packages/41/64/5417dc693f4aa3cfc194c7f491cb3e88567de2214ecfb330caac57611870/wwx-0.1.1.tar.gz#sha256=57a4243adc13f9e91ab7db70ffb7da88c01447eff594727232f46f3c1be6d107
03-17 03:06